实现“三连击(升级版) python”

引言

作为一名经验丰富的开发者,我很高兴能够帮助你实现“三连击(升级版) python”。在本文中,我将向你介绍整个实现过程,并提供每个步骤所需的代码和解释。

整个实现过程

为了更好地理解实现过程,下面是一个展示整个流程的表格:

步骤 描述
步骤 1 获取用户输入的三个数值
步骤 2 计算三个数值的和
步骤 3 计算三个数值的积
步骤 4 打印结果

接下来,我将详细介绍每个步骤需要做什么,并提供相应的代码和注释。

步骤 1:获取用户输入的三个数值

首先,我们需要获取用户输入的三个数值。这可以通过使用input()函数来实现。下面是相应的代码:

num1 = float(input("请输入第一个数值:"))
num2 = float(input("请输入第二个数值:"))
num3 = float(input("请输入第三个数值:"))

在这段代码中,我们使用了input()函数来获取用户的输入,并使用float()将输入转换为浮点数类型。我们在变量名前加上了num前缀以表示这些变量是用来存储数值的。

步骤 2:计算三个数值的和

接下来,我们需要计算这三个数值的和。这可以通过简单地将这三个数值相加来实现。下面是相应的代码:

total = num1 + num2 + num3

在这段代码中,我们将三个数值相加,并将结果存储在变量total中。

步骤 3:计算三个数值的积

然后,我们需要计算这三个数值的积。这可以通过将这三个数值相乘来实现。下面是相应的代码:

product = num1 * num2 * num3

在这段代码中,我们将三个数值相乘,并将结果存储在变量product中。

步骤 4:打印结果

最后,我们需要将结果打印出来。这可以通过使用print()函数来实现。下面是相应的代码:

print("三个数值的和为:", total)
print("三个数值的积为:", product)

在这段代码中,我们使用print()函数将结果打印出来。我们在输出语句中使用逗号来分隔字符串和变量,以将它们连接在一起。

代码汇总

现在,让我们汇总一下上述代码:

num1 = float(input("请输入第一个数值:"))
num2 = float(input("请输入第二个数值:"))
num3 = float(input("请输入第三个数值:"))

total = num1 + num2 + num3
product = num1 * num2 * num3

print("三个数值的和为:", total)
print("三个数值的积为:", product)

流程图

为了更好地可视化整个流程,下面是一个使用Mermaid语法的流程图:

graph LR
A[用户输入三个数值] --> B[计算三个数值的和]
B --> C[计算三个数值的积]
C --> D[打印结果]

甘特图

最后,我们使用Mermaid语法的甘特图来表示整个实现过程:

gantt
dateFormat YYYY-MM-DD
title 三连击(升级版) python 实现过程
section 实现过程
获取用户输入的三个数值 :done, 2022-01-01, 1d
计算三个数值的和 :done, 2022-01-02, 1d
计算三个数值的积 :done, 2022-01-03, 1d
打印结果 :done,